#[repr(i32)]pub enum VerificationUnitLevel {
Unspecified = 0,
DerivedUnit = 1,
EnclosingUnit = 2,
None = 3,
}Expand description
The level of organizational unit a verification question is put at.
Verification asks somebody other than the audience whether the behaviour changed for a unit. Which unit that is has two sides pulling against each other.
A size floor pushes the choice upward: below a handful of people, an answer about the unit is in practice an answer about each of its members, and the whole reason for asking about a unit rather than about individuals disappears. Sensitivity pushes the choice downward: a measure is only worth reading when whoever answers can influence what is being asked about, and a question put far above the work stops reflecting anybody’s effort while still looking like a measurement. The level worth choosing is the smallest one that clears the floor.
Which levels exist is a fact about the organization and only the organization can state it. A reporting line is not a map of meaningful units — units that report to the same place may do unrelated work — so a level is never inferred from one. When no level satisfies both sides, the honest outcome is that the indicator gets no evidence by this route, and this enum makes that expressible instead of leaving it looking like a question that was asked.
Variants§
Unspecified = 0
No level chosen. On an indicator this means the organization’s default applies; on the organization it means the platform default applies, which is VERIFICATION_UNIT_LEVEL_DERIVED_UNIT. Consumers MUST NOT present this value as a choice somebody made.
DerivedUnit = 1
Ask at the unit the verifier derivation resolves to. The smallest level available, and therefore the one whose answers track the work most closely. The floor still applies here: a unit below it is not asked at this level and contributes nothing, so a reading covers only the units that cleared the floor and never every unit the derivation reached.
EnclosingUnit = 2
Ask at the wider unit the organization’s declared structure places over the derived one. This is what rising above the floor looks like when the organization has somewhere to rise to, and the organization is the one that says so. The cost is paid in sensitivity: whoever answers is further from the work, and an answer covering a unit whose parts do unrelated things says less about any of them. Where the organization has declared no level above, or the wider unit is itself below the floor, no question is asked and no evidence is produced.
None = 3
Do not ask by this route at all. The indicator keeps whatever other evidence sources it has and simply gets none from verification. This is the outcome for an organization flat enough that no level clears the floor, and it is a decision rather than a failure: consumers MUST NOT show it as a collection that is pending, overdue or broken.
Implementations§
Source§impl VerificationUnitLevel
impl VerificationUnitLevel
Sourcepub const fn is_valid(value: i32) -> bool
pub const fn is_valid(value: i32) -> bool
Returns true if value is a variant of VerificationUnitLevel.
Sourcepub fn from_i32(value: i32) -> Option<VerificationUnitLevel>
👎Deprecated: Use the TryFrom<i32> implementation instead
pub fn from_i32(value: i32) -> Option<VerificationUnitLevel>
Use the TryFrom<i32> implementation instead
Converts an i32 to a VerificationUnitLevel, or None if value is not a valid variant.
Source§impl VerificationUnitLevel
impl VerificationUnitLevel
Sourcepub fn as_str_name(&self) -> &'static str
pub fn as_str_name(&self) -> &'static str
String value of the enum field names used in the ProtoBuf definition.
The values are not transformed in any way and thus are considered stable (if the ProtoBuf definition does not change) and safe for programmatic use.
Sourcepub fn from_str_name(value: &str) -> Option<Self>
pub fn from_str_name(value: &str) -> Option<Self>
Creates an enum from field names used in the ProtoBuf definition.
